Zamfara lawmakers impeach Speaker over insecurity

The members of the Zamfara State House of Assembly have impeached the Speaker, Bilyaminu Moriki, over insecurity in the state.

The lawmakers, who impeached Moriki at an emergency meeting on Thursday night, also appointed Bashar Gummi as the pro-tempo Speaker of the House.

The development followed a motion by the lawmaker representing Maru Constituency, Nasiru Abdullahi, and endorsed by 18 out of the 24 members of the House.

The 18 lawmakers unanimously agreed to impeach the Speaker, noting that the House failed to tackle the security challenges bewildering Zamfara State.

They however urged the appointed pro-temporal Speaker to use his position to end insecurity which they said has almost crippled socio-economic activities in the state.

Speaking at the meeting, one of the lawmakers, Shamsudeen Basko, said: “I have two issues, but an observation was made on one, which is that of insecurity which has been disturbing our people. Our people are being killed and abducted on a daily basis.

“What are we doing in the Assembly? We need to stand up and do something to defend our people. This is because the armed bandits are invading local government headquarters unchallenged. Let us call on the government to act now to protect our people.”
